Output ea895e64316f5554eed9fed305066ff3a8c1162f19d52ee6fb27e01bc8e32819:7

value
22915558
script pubkey
OP_0 OP_PUSHBYTES_20 bd74145c5048eeae5215c7d177de6e4878d81af1
address
bc1qh46pghzsfrh2u5s4clgh0hnwfpudsxh3z6gz6x
transaction
ea895e64316f5554eed9fed305066ff3a8c1162f19d52ee6fb27e01bc8e32819
spent
true